PLAN VIEW OFF SINCE UCS COMMAND (pics attached)

Hello,

 

I am trying to figure out why my view is now not perfectly in plan view rather at some angle allowing me to see the depth of objects such as manholes.

 

I used the UCS command and since then this has persisted. Its not just a visualization. My paper space texts are no in the wrong locations relative to the new view angle.

 

Ive attached pics for clarity

Is it possible the UCS got inadvertently twisted?  I would try UCS > World, and then PLAN to see if everything looks good in the world coordinate system.  Then re-establish your UCS, followed by a PLAN command and then see how things look.
